Table 1
Robert Hoppocks Suggestions for Choosing a Career

Learn about all of the activities in a job you are considering and the time spent conducting each activity.
Consider not only the pay and prestige of a job, but also whether you will like the work itself.
Choose a job that is in demand.
Match your competencies to those of the job.
Remember that interest ability.
Admiring someone who chose a job does not mean that you should choose that job as well.
Nearly every job will include some activities that you dislike performing.
